遇到沒起作用的css是因為特殊性衝突,在選擇器前面新增父元素的id可以增加特殊性
計算特殊性的方法
a:行內樣式,優先順序最高,a=1 只有行內樣式1000
b:id選擇器總數
c:類、偽類、屬性選擇器數量
d:標籤選擇器和偽元素選擇器數量
十進位制下計算abcd值
ie6及以下在混雜模式下使用自己的非標準盒模型
width=content+2*border+2*padding
box-sizing屬性用於指定使用哪種盒模型,預設為content-box即width只代表content的寬
只有普通文件流中塊框的垂直外邊距才會發生外邊距疊加,行內框 浮動框 絕對定位框之間的外邊距不會疊加
選擇器優先順序 CSS選擇器優先順序總結
css選擇器優先順序這個問題,相信有點經驗前端都會認為非常簡單,但是我們今天還是來總結一下吧。相信大家應該很少直接在html頁面寫樣式吧,一般都是用link標籤匯入css樣式表。使用者自定義樣式表就是我們用link標籤引入的css樣式表,為了保持不同瀏覽器下樣式相同,所以我們的自定義樣式表一般都會覆...
選擇器 優先順序 計算規則
css選擇器分為簡單選擇器,偽元素選擇器和組合選擇器。簡單選擇器又分為標籤選擇器,類選擇器,id選擇器,萬用字元選擇器,屬性選擇器和偽類選擇器。css中權重最高的樣式為行內樣式,就是以style 方式直接加入到html標籤內的樣式,其在css優先順序中具有最高的權重。其次是id選擇器,id選擇器由於...
選擇器,優先順序
內聯式css樣式表就是把css 直接寫在現有的html標籤中,如下面 這裡文字是紅色。盡量不要把css 寫成內部樣式 縮排統一。2.嵌入式css樣式,就是可以把css樣式 寫在標籤之間。3.外部式css樣式 也可稱為外聯式 就是把css 寫乙個單獨的外部檔案中,這個css樣式檔案以 css 注意 1...